The Ultimate Guide to Local SEO in Kenya: Dominate Search in Nairobi, Thika & Beyond

For any business in Kenya, from a hardware shop in Thika to a restaurant in Westlands, the most valuable traffic doesn’t come from around the world—it comes from right around the corner. Local SEO (Search Engine Optimization) is the strategic process of optimizing your online presence to attract high-quality customers from relevant local searches on Google and other search engines.

Imagine a potential customer in Ruiru searching for “best interior designer near me” or a resident in Nairobi typing “emergency plumber Nairobi.” If your business doesn’t appear in those crucial first results, you’re missing out on ready-to-buy leads. This guide will walk you through the essential steps to ensure your Kenyan business is visible to your local community.

Why Local SEO is Non-Negotiable for Kenyan Businesses

The digital landscape in Kenya is mobile-first and hyper-local. With widespread smartphone adoption, consumers instinctively turn to Google Search or Maps to find products and services. A strong Local SEO strategy ensures you:

  • Capture High-Intent Traffic: Users searching with “near me” or location terms are often ready to make a purchase or visit.

  • Build Community Trust: Appearing in local listings with positive reviews makes your business a familiar and trusted name.

  • Outcompete Larger Brands: A well-optimized local presence allows a SME in Kitengela to outrank a corporate chain for specific local searches.

Your 7-Step Action Plan for Local SEO Success in Kenya

1. Claim & Perfect Your Google Business Profile (GBP)

This is your single most important local SEO asset. It’s the profile that appears in Google Search and Maps.

  • Action: If you haven’t already, go to Google Business Profile and claim your listing. For complete accuracy, ensure your:

    • Business Name, Address, and Phone Number (NAP) are consistent everywhere online.

    • Business Category is precise (e.g., “Real Estate Consultant” not just “Consultant”).

    • Profile includes high-quality photos of your storefront, team, and products.

    • Posts are used weekly to share updates, offers, or events.

2. Cultivate & Manage Customer Reviews

Reviews are critical social proof. Google’s algorithm favours businesses with a healthy flow of genuine, positive reviews.

  • Action: Proactively and politely ask satisfied customers to leave a review on your GBP. Always respond professionally to every review— thanking customers for positive feedback and addressing any concerns raised in negative reviews publicly and constructively.

3. Optimize for “Near Me” and Local Keyword Phrases

Incorporate location-based keywords naturally into your website’s content.

  • Action: Beyond your primary services, create content around phrases like:

    • Service + Location: e.g., “Website design services in Nairobi

    • Service + “Near Me”: e.g., “SEO agency near me

    • City-Specific Content: Write a blog post titled “A Guide to Choosing a Solar Installer in Nakuru.”

4. Ensure NAP Consistency Across the Web

Inconsistent listings confuse customers and hurt your search rankings.

  • Action: Audit your business listings on major Kenyan directories like Hotkenya.comKenyaBusinessList.org, and industry-specific sites. Ensure your NAP details are identical everywhere.

5. Build Local Links & Citations

Links from other reputable local websites (like chambers of commerce, news sites, or event directories) act as votes of confidence for your business.

  • Action: Partner with complementary local businesses for collaborations, sponsor a community event in Thika, or get featured in a local online publication. Each mention with a link back to your site strengthens your local authority.

6. Create Locally Relevant Content

Become a local authority by creating content that resonates with your community’s interests and needs.

  • Action: Start a blog on your website. Write about local news, events, or issues related to your industry. For example, a pharmacy in Mombasa could write about “Managing Allergies in Mombasa’s Coastal Climate.”

7. Optimize for Mobile Users

The vast majority of local searches happen on mobile phones. A slow, poorly designed mobile site will drive customers away.

  • Action: Use tools like Google’s Mobile-Friendly Test to check your site. Ensure it loads quickly, text is readable without zooming, and tap targets (like buttons) are well-spaced.

Common Local SEO Pitfalls to Avoid in Kenya

  • Incomplete GBP: A profile with no photos, outdated hours, or missing information appears unprofessional and is ranked lower.

  • Ignoring Reviews: Unanswered reviews, especially negative ones, signal poor customer service.

  • Creating Generic Content: Content that isn’t tailored for a Kenyan audience misses the mark on relevance and connection.

  • Forgetting Technical SEO: A website that isn’t fast or secure (HTTPS) will be penalised in search rankings, regardless of other efforts.
